The decor is simple with bold colors and Greek-themed art. The food is truly Greek; this is one of few area restaurants serving Greek food and wine. Start with Kefalograviera Cheese, fried and served with Roasted Red Peppers, or the delicious Spanikopita, a Greek spinach pie with feta and dill. The slow-cooked meats are done to a turn; Braised Lamb Shank with mint sauce and Rabbit Stew in a Port Wine Reduction. Traditional Moussaka is another popular entree. Choose a full-bodied Greek wine to complement the meal. Opah! See website for menus and more.
